Claims
- 1. A disturbance compensation control system which restricts periodic disturbance of a motor comprising:
means for calculating a target rotation speed of the motor; means for calculating an actual rotation speed of the motor; means for calculating a difference between the target rotation speed of the motor and the actual rotation speed of the motor; and a repetition control unit which receives the calculated difference between the target rotation speed of the motor and the actual rotation speed of the motor, and repeatedly applies a compensated value to the calculated difference, the compensated value applied by the repetition control unit during initial starting of the control object being based on a zero value of the difference between the target rotation speed of the motor and the actual rotation speed of the motor.
- 2. The disturbance compensation control system according to claim 1, wherein the repetition control includes an initial repetition compensation controller provided with a memory which stores the difference between the target rotation speed and the actual rotation speed a previous first cycle operation.
- 3. The disturbance compensation control system according to claim 1, wherein the repetition control unit includes a masking processor, a repetition compensator controller and a phase converter, the masking processor outputting the zero value to the repetition compensator controller during initial starting of the control object and outputting the difference between the target rotation speed and the actual rotation speed to the repetition compensator controller after initial starting of the motor.
- 4. The disturbance compensation control system according to claim 3, wherein the repetition control unit also includes an initial repetition compensation controller provided with a memory which stores the difference between the target rotation speed of the motor and the actual rotation speed of the motor during a previous first cycle operation of the control object.
- 5. The disturbance compensation control system according to claim 1, including a differential calculator which differentiates the difference between the target rotation speed of the motor and the actual rotation speed of the motor, and an integral calculator which integrates the difference between the target rotation speed of the motor and the actual rotation speed of the motor.
- 6. A disturbance compensation control system which restricts periodic disturbance of a control object comprising:
means for calculating a target control condition of the control object; means for calculating an actual control condition of the control object; means for calculating a difference between the target control condition of the control object and the actual control condition of the control object; and a repetition control unit which receives the calculated difference between the target control condition and the actual control condition, and applies a value to the calculated difference, the value applied by the repetition control unit during initial starting of the control object being based on a zero value of the difference between the target control condition and the actual control condition.
- 7. The disturbance compensation control system according to claim 6, wherein the repetition control unit includes a phase converter.
- 8. The disturbance compensation control system according to claim 7, wherein the repetition control unit also includes an initial repetition compensation controller provided with a memory which stores the difference between the target control condition and the actual control condition during a previous first cycle operation.
- 9. The disturbance compensation control system according to claim 6, wherein the repetition control unit includes a masking processor, a repetition compensator controller and a phase converter, the masking processor outputting the zero value to the repetition compensator controller during initial starting of the control object and outputting the difference between the target control condition and the actual control condition to the repetition compensator controller after initial starting of the control object.
- 10. The disturbance compensation control system according to claim 9, wherein the repetition control unit also includes an initial repetition compensation controller provided with a memory which stores the difference between the target control condition and the actual control condition during a previous first cycle operation of the control object.
- 11. The disturbance compensation control system according to claim 6, wherein the control object is a motor.
- 12. The disturbance compensation control system according to claim 6, including a differential calculator which differentiates the difference between the target control condition and the actual control condition, and an integral calculator which integrates the difference between the target control condition and the actual control condition.
- 13. A disturbance compensation control system which restricts periodic disturbance of a control object comprising:
means for calculating a target control condition; means for calculating an actual control condition; means for calculating a difference between the target control condition and the actual control condition; and a repetition control unit which receives the calculated difference between the target control condition and the actual control condition, and applies a value to the calculated difference, the repetition control unit including a phase converter.
- 14. The disturbance compensation control system according to claim 13, wherein the repetition control unit also includes an initial repetition compensation controller provided with a memory which stores the difference between the target control condition and the actual control condition during a previous first cycle operation of the control object.
- 15. The disturbance compensation control system according to claim 13, wherein the repetition control unit includes a masking processor, a repetition compensator controller and a phase converter, the masking processor outputting the difference between the target control condition and the actual control condition to the repetition compensator controller after initial starting of the control object.
- 16. The disturbance compensation control system according to claim 15, wherein the repetition control unit also includes an initial repetition compensation controller provided with a memory which stores the difference between the target control condition and the actual control condition during a previous first cycle operation.
- 17. The disturbance compensation control system according to claim 13, wherein the control object is a motor.
- 18. The disturbance compensation control system according to claim 13, including a differential calculator which differentiates the difference between the target control condition and the actual control condition, and an integral calculator which integrates the difference between the target control condition and the actual control condition.
- 19. The disturbance compensation control system according to claim 13, wherein the repetition control unit includes a masking processor which outputs a signal and a repetition compensator controller which receives the signal output from the masking processor and outputs a signal, the phase converter receiving the signal from the repetition compensator controller and shifting a phase of the signal output from the repetition compensator controller.
Priority Claims (1)
Number |
Date |
Country |
Kind |
2000-398574 |
Dec 2000 |
JP |
|
Parent Case Info
[0001] This application is based on and claims priority under 35 U.S.C. §119 with respect to Japanese Application No. 2000-398574 filed on Dec. 27, 2000, the entire content of which is incorporated herein by reference.